Celebrate Juneteenth in Rochester, NY!
Juneteenth marks the historic end of enslavement* in the United States. It honors the day when enslaved individuals in Texas, finally received word of their freedom, more than two years after the Emancipation Proclamation went into effect.
*enslavement is still legal when it comes to persons “convicted of a crime” per the 13th amendment. A really big loophole that’s led to the over policing and incarceration of Black folks.
